Output 62af72e61fc4965e9985931f6ba8b7a553778e6f5dbb9e702909f57cf336f10a:0

value
157388588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faaa8d4156fa1c830ede71998ce34ce3689890d5 OP_EQUAL
address
3QYRAeTca7NQ2Vf5M3iEHif38JNiYLsfz3
transaction
62af72e61fc4965e9985931f6ba8b7a553778e6f5dbb9e702909f57cf336f10a
spent
true